Patent number: 10959906Abstract: Conditioning devices for gainers and eSports athletes are presented. The devices includes a wrist rest device, a massage sleeve, a hand exercise bracelet, a knuckle bracelet and a tri-finger exercise device. The wrist rest device is configured to provide appropriate warmth to the forearms while gaming, using a keyboard, or any data input device. The massage sleeve is configured to be wrapped around a person's forearm. It includes multiple elevated geometric shapes that are be built into the fabric of the material to provide appropriate pressure along the musculature of the wrist and forearm. The hand exercise bracelet, the knuckle bracelet and the tri-finger exercise device are configured for increasing the flexion, extension, abduction, adduction and intrinsic muscle strength of fingers, wrists, and forearms especially for individuals who do extensive amounts of keyboarding as well as texting, typing, gaming, and data entry.Type: GrantFiled: February 2, 2017Date of Patent: March 30, 2021Assignee: HARRISON LEGACY 301, LLCInventor: Danny Levi Harrison

Patent number: 10512590Abstract: A knuckle bracelet and hand exercise device includes a main body with two elongated branches, i.e. a first branch and a second branch. Each of the elongated branches includes a plurality of digit holes along its length. Each one of the plurality of digit holes is configured for a single digit of a person's hand. A hinge couples together the first branch and the second branch in a side-by-side configuration next to the digit holes configured for the thumbs of the person's left and right hands.Type: GrantFiled: February 2, 2017Date of Patent: December 24, 2019Assignee: HARRISON LEGACY 301, LLCInventor: Danny Levi Harrison

Patent number: 7583678Abstract: Methods and apparatus are disclosed for scheduling entities in a system, such as, but not limited to a computer or communications system. Typically, calendar scheduling is used as a primary scheduling mechanism, with spare time allocated to a secondary scheduling mechanism. The secondary scheduling mechanism can use a round robin technique or variant thereof, or any other scheduling methodology. A calendar entry is examined to determine whether to process a calendar scheduled entity corresponding to the calendar entry or to process a secondary scheduled entity. Which scheduling entity to process is typically determined based on an eligibility of an entity corresponding to the primary scheduled event, a scheduling mechanism indicator, and/or an entity indicator. These combinations of scheduling mechanisms can be used to identify which packets to send, queues or ports to access, processes or threads to execute, or for any other purpose.Type: GrantFiled: September 27, 2002Date of Patent: September 1, 2009Assignee: Cisco Technology, IncInventors: Danny Levy, Dalit Sagi
